In photography, the compound of nitrogen used is 

A) Potassium nitrate B) Silver nitrate
C) Ammonium carbonate D) Ammonium bicarbonate
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: B) Silver nitrate

Explanation:

Silver nitrate is the basic substance from which silver bromide is obtained. The photographic films are impregnated with the light sensitive AgBr.

What are the four steps to the briefing process?

Answer

Military Staffs normally follow four steps when preparing an effective briefing. They are:


 


1. Plan — analyze the situation and prepare a briefing outline.


2. Prepare — collect information and construct the briefing.


3. Execute — deliver the briefing.


4. Assess — follow up as required.

Which color has the highest frequency?

A) Violet B) Red
C) Indigo D) Green
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: A) Violet

Explanation:

In VIBGYOR. It has colors ordered from highest to lowest frequency.

 

              Violet > Indigo > Blue > Green > Yellow > Orange > Red

 

That says Violet has the highest frequency.

We know, Speed of light = Frequency x Wavelength

=> As frequeny is inversely proportional to wavelength i.e, as frequwncy goes high wavelength goes down.

 

So, the violet color has the highest frequency.
